The Scribe Who Learned to Write the Heavens
In the heart of an ancient civilization, nestled between towering mountains and the whispering sea, there stood a library known as the Papyrus of Eternity. Within its walls, the scrolls whispered tales of old, of a time when the scribes were the keepers of the heavens. Among these scribes was a young man named Aelion, whose fingers danced across the parchment with a rhythm that was as old as time itself.
Aelion was no ordinary scribe. His eyes held the weight of the cosmos, and his heart was a wellspring of ancient wisdom. He spent his days copying texts and his nights poring over the most sacred of scrolls, those that spoke of the celestial mechanics and the very fabric of the universe. It was said that one day, a scribe would learn to write the heavens themselves, and Aelion felt the call of destiny upon him.
One moonless night, as Aelion sat by the fire, a whispering voice echoed through the room. "Scribe Aelion, listen closely. The secrets of the heavens are yours to uncover, but they come at a great cost."
Startled, Aelion looked around, but the room was empty. The voice was not one he could place, and yet it seemed to resonate with his soul. He dismissed it as the fancy of his imagination, yet the thought lingered.
Days turned to weeks, and Aelion's search for the secret of the heavens grew ever more fervent. He delved deeper into the ancient scrolls, deciphering runes and symbols that had been forgotten by time. It was during this quest that he stumbled upon a scroll unlike any other, one that spoke of a lost language that could only be written in the air.
The scroll was inscribed with cryptic instructions, and Aelion's heart raced as he realized its significance. It spoke of a ritual that required the scribe to write in the rarefied air above the city, using the breath of the stars as ink. To do so, one must first learn to harness the very essence of the heavens.
Determined to uncover the truth, Aelion set out to perform the ritual. He climbed the tallest mountain, where the winds were as sharp as the peaks and the sky was a tapestry of constellations. As the first light of dawn painted the sky with hues of gold and pink, Aelion stood at the edge, his heart pounding with anticipation.
He opened the scroll and began to speak the ancient words, his voice a soft hum against the morning breeze. The air around him shimmered, and he felt the cosmic energy flow through him. His hands reached out, and he wrote a single word in the sky: "Heaven."
The word remained, a beacon against the backdrop of the cosmos, and Aelion knew that he had succeeded. He had learned to write the heavens.
But as he stood there, the sky began to change, and the constellations shifted into a new pattern. The words of the scroll seemed to take on a life of their own, and Aelion felt a surge of power that coursed through his veins. He wrote another word, and another, until the entire sky was filled with his writing.
The earth trembled, and the stars wavered. The city below was enveloped in a blinding light, and Aelion knew that he had tapped into a force beyond his understanding. The heavens themselves were listening to his words.
In that moment, Aelion realized that he had not only learned to write the heavens but had also become one with them. The knowledge he had gained was not just of the stars but of the very essence of existence. He had become the scribe who learned to write the heavens, and in doing so, he had rewritten the fabric of reality.
As the light faded, the city returned to its quiet ways, but Aelion was forever changed. He returned to the Papyrus of Eternity, not as a mere scribe, but as a guardian of the cosmos. The scrolls no longer whispered tales, but sang songs of the universe, and Aelion was their interpreter.
He spent his days writing the heavens, his words a symphony of creation. And though he could no longer see the stars, he felt their light within him, a reminder that he was a part of something far greater than himself.
The scribe who learned to write the heavens had not only discovered the secret of the universe but had also found his place in it, a beacon of knowledge and wisdom for all who would listen.
